Food Thread: Lamb, Mac & Cheese, And The Perils Of Eating Food

Lambcauliflower26.jpg

Why yes, that does look delicious! That is a friend's 4H lamb after it was lovingly roasted in his pizza oven. The particulars of the recipe are a bit hazy, for reasons that I will leave to your imagination, but might have to do with fermented grapes.

What I find interesting about that sort of cooking is that the temperature is variable and not easily adjustable, so the cook actually has to pay attention to the food! That is by no means an onerous demand, in fact it is part of the joy of cooking, but it is a requirement when using fire!

Cauliflowerlamb26.jpg

That is cauliflower roasted in the same oven, and I had a hard time deciding which food deserved to be on the main page! The cauliflower was delicious! Cooked perfectly, with a delicious herb dressing topped with pomegranate seeds and pine nuts. It's also a great looking presentation!

One of the pleasures of some Italian cooking is how ridiculously simple it is. Sure, they have their share of complex recipes, but a lot of italian cooking is ingredient-driven and delightfully simple. Here is a link for spaghetti aglio e olio, which is pretty damned simple, and pretty damned delicious. Hell, this is from a cook book writer from NYC, which is a testament to the simplicity of the dish and how widespread Italian cooking is!

I am sick and f*cking tired of the hysterical over-reaction to food-borne illness in America. We have much better reporting systems now than we did in previous generations. We have amazingly sensitive diagnostic tests that detect pathogens at minuscule concentrations. And we have a media that are maniacal in their desire to amplify every bit of equivocal data into some worldwide pandemic.

Yes, we have food-borne illness. No, it is not a crisis. No it is not increasing much, if at all.

Do you want to minimize your risk? Wash produce before consuming. learn basic food safety techniques to minimize cross-contamination. Don't eat day-old tacos from the illegal stand on the corner. Wash your hands with hot soapy water before during and after cooking.

Yeah...nothing particularly complicated there!

I would add: minimize eating take-out food or prepared food. But that's because I don't much trust strangers to follow the simple, basic rules of food safety.

Like the five-second rule! Because being afraid of food is just silly, and the media desperately tries to make us terrified!

Rumor has it that the Bourbon Bubble is bursting. I have seen no evidence of decreasing prices, but maybe the bursting started somewhere else! I think the sweet spot is $40-$60 for excellent and interesting bottles, and bumping that to $100 gets you an incremental improvement in quality, but nothing mind-blowing. More than that and I think you are paying for hype and rarity, which may look good in your liquor cabinet, but doesn't translate to more quality in the bottle.

The problem...or the solution...is to buy lots of bourbon, take tasting notes, and eventually arrive at your favorites! It should take forty or fifty years, but it is worth it!
